Transaction 22e6b4f6250d4bcabc9cf7dd50eef5b4d6b2412ac65261c992bf50c3c94ff26b

58 Input
2 Outputs
  • 22e6b4f6250d4bcabc9cf7dd50eef5b4d6b2412ac65261c992bf50c3c94ff26b:0
  • value  252113430
    address  35Rs9vTy8u5RWvL5ehPjQhDzi9o4Tf2j6W
  • 22e6b4f6250d4bcabc9cf7dd50eef5b4d6b2412ac65261c992bf50c3c94ff26b:1
  • value  15240579766
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r